Output 3d574c21159a01aef89dd964dc004cb36b545f10a2525bbe115514443c96433e:0

value
1530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8cad421696e9cbf3d1a9100095d300ced7ea31 OP_EQUAL
address
37DAzSxGveYdVfnsPGEiWqFuCB9cV8jR5E
transaction
3d574c21159a01aef89dd964dc004cb36b545f10a2525bbe115514443c96433e
spent
true